Ask the question a different way and the solution may become obvious to you. 63 is 15% of what number is the same as asking, 63 = 15% (or better, .15) * some #. But we always solve with the unknown \"some number\" on one side of the = sign and everything else on the other. \n" ); document.write( "... \n" ); document.write( "Let x = the unknown # \n" ); document.write( "... \n" ); document.write( "63 = .15 x can be rewritten by dividing both sides by .15 \n" ); document.write( "... \n" ); document.write( "x = 63/.15 \n" ); document.write( "x = 420 is the answer. \n" ); document.write( "... \n" ); document.write( "check your work by solving for your original question: \n" ); document.write( "420 * .15 = ? \n" ); document.write( "420 * .15 = 63 checks. \n" ); document.write( "... \n" ); document.write( "cheers, \n" ); document.write( "Lee \n" ); document.write( " |
